Abstract
PROBLEM Antiphospholipid antibodies (aPLs) are a group of autoantibodies associated with a variety of pregnancy complications, but the impact of aPL on the outcomes of assisted fertility treatment (ART) is controversial. This systematic review and meta-analysis were designed to explore the association between aPL and ART outcomes and to explore in which stages does aPL play a role. METHOD OF STUDY PubMed and Cochrane database were systematically retrieved, and odds ratios (ORs) or risk ratios (RRs) with 95% confidence intervals (CIs) were calculated in a random-effect model or fixed-effect model according to the heterogenicity assessed by the Cochran Q and I2 statistic test. Of 246 records identified by the search, 10 case-control studies and 13 cohort studies that explored the association between aPL and in vitro fertilization (IVF) and/or intracytoplasmic sperm injection (ICSI) were analyzed. RESULTS The results showed that aPL positive rate was higher in females who failed in IVF/ICSI than those who succeeded in IVF/ICSI (OR: 3.62, 95% CI: 1.95-6.74). This study also indicated that females positive for aPL have a higher miscarriage rate (RR: 1.68, 95% CI: 1.24-2.28) than those negative for aPL, but live birth rate, biochemical pregnancy rate, and clinical pregnancy rate were similar between two groups (RR: 1.01, 95% CI: 0.91-1.12; RR: 1.18, 95% CI: 0.57-2.43 and RR: 0.95, 95% CI: 0.80-1.13). CONCLUSIONS There was higher aPL prevalence in females with adverse IVF/ICSI outcomes. It seems that aPL mainly affects the miscarriage rate, but has little effect on live birth rate, biochemical pregnancy rate, and clinical pregnancy rate. Routine detection of aPL before IVF/ICSI treatment is meaningful.

Abstract
PROBLEM We investigated the beta2-glycoprotein I and anti-annexin V antibodies as anti-phospholipid-cofactor antibodies; and factor V G1691A Leiden, prothrombin G20210A, and methylenetetrahydrofolate reductase (MTHFR) C677T mutations as hereditary thrombophilia in recurrent pregnancy losses (RPL). METHOD OF STUDY Study group consisted of 84 women with recurrent pregnancy loss and control group consisted of 84 women having at least one live birth. RESULTS Methylenetetrahydrofolate reductase C677T homozygous mutation was detected in 28.5% of the study group and in 14.2% of the controls, and the difference was highly significant (P < 0.001). Heterozygous mutation of this gene was found in 64.3% of the study population and in 38.1% of the controls, and difference in heterozygous mutation frequency was also significant (P < 0.001). Both homozygous and heterozygous mutations of PT G20210A and factor V G1691A were not different between the groups. There was no significant difference in anti-annexin V levels and anti-beta2-gp 1 levels of the groups. CONCLUSION We concluded that both homozygous and heterozygous mutations of MTHFR C677T were related with RPL in Caucasian women.

Abstract
Abstract
Thrombophilia has been associated with pregnancy complications and recurrent miscarriage. The aim of this systematic review was to evaluate the controversial association between thrombophilia and failures of assisted reproduction technology (ART). A systematic search of the literature for studies reporting on thrombophilia in women undergoing ART up to April 2011 yielded 33 studies (23 evaluating anti-phospholipid antibodies, 5 inherited thrombophilia, and 5 both) involving 6092 patients. Overall, methodologic quality of the studies was poor. Combined results from case-control studies showed that factor V Leiden was significantly more prevalent among women with ART failure compared with fertile parous women or those achieving pregnancy after ART (odds ratio = 3.08; 95% confidence interval, 1.77-5.36). The prothrombin mutation, methylenetetrahydrofolate reductase mutation, deficiency of protein S, protein C, or anti-thrombin were all not associated with ART failure. Women with ART failure tested more frequently positive for anti-phospholipids antibodies (odds ratio = 3.33; 95% confidence interval, 1.77-6.26) with evidence of high degree of between-study heterogeneity (I2 = 75%; P < .00001). Prospective cohort studies did not show significant associations between thrombophilia and ART outcomes. Although case-control studies suggest that women experiencing ART failures are more frequently positive for factor V Leiden and anti-phospholipid antibodies, the evidence is inconclusive and not supported by cohort studies.

Abstract
Antiphospholipid antibodies, i.e. lupus anticoagulants and anticardiolipin antibodies, are associated with obstetric complications. Fetal death and recurrent spontaneous abortions represent the obstetric criteria of the antiphospholipid syndrome. They occur with similar frequences and have an overall prevalence of 15-20%. Lupus anticoagulants carry a risk 3.0 to 4.8 times, and anticardiolipin antibodies 0.86 to 20 times higher than controls. The mechanism(s) by which antiphospholipid antibodies cause these events still has to be defined: thrombosis in the placental vessels, and impairment of embryonic implantation have been proposed. Unfractionated or low-molecular-weight heparin, alone or in combination with low-dose aspirin, represent the current standard treatment of pregnant antiphospholipid-positive women for preventing recurrent obstetric complications. Upon treatment, the live birth rate increases from 0-40% to 70-80%. However, there is still an excessive frequency of maternal and/or fetal complications, indicating the necessity of a better calibration of the dosage, duration and timing of administration of heparin treatment.

Abstract
PURPOSE OF REVIEW Much attention has been paid to the role of immunology in reproductive success or failure. Every step in the establishment of normal pregnancy has been implicated as a possible site of immune-mediated reproductive failure. The widespread testing of antiphospholipid, antinuclear, antithyroid, and antisperm antibodies, as well as generalized immune testing, have thus been employed to diagnose patients with otherwise unexplained infertility or recurrent pregnancy loss. Controversial data surrounding the widespread and variable use of immune testing in current fertility practice is reviewed to determine which tests are warranted based on sound scientific evidence. Because it is postulated that early miscarriage, when occult, could represent a failure of embryo implantation indistinguishable from unexplained infertility, this analysis of immune testing includes a discussion of patients with recurrent pregnancy loss. RECENT FINDINGS Despite the increased prevalence of abnormal immune testing associated with early reproductive failure, the most rigorous studies have not proven a cause and effect between these phenomena. There is wide variation and inconsistency regarding this association, depending upon which test(s) are employed, the study methodology used, and the patient population under study. The significance of selected immunological test abnormalities associated with early reproductive failure is uncertain. SUMMARY Great variability exists in identifying candidates for immune testing, determining which tests to order, interpreting the test results, and offering immunologic treatments. This review argues that the use of widespread immune testing in clinical practice can not be supported by existing data. The resulting therapies are similarly of unconfirmed benefit and may cause harm.

Abstract
OBJECTIVE To document the clinical association between the history of pregnancy loss in patients with the diagnosis of primary or secondary antiphospholipid syndrome (APS) and the presence of different antiprothrombin antibody subtypes [immunoglobulin G (IgG), IgM and IgA] in a cohort of patients with APS. METHODS Records of 170 female patients with primary APS, or APS secondary to systemic lupus erythematosus (SLE) or secondary to other autoimmune diseases were studied. RESULTS In female APS patients with IgG antiprothrombin antibodies (n = 105) significant associations to pregnancy loss (p < 0.0001), early pregnancy loss (p < 0.0001) and a negative association to thrombocytopenia (p < 0.01) could be identified. In the group of patients with IgG antiprothrombin antibodies and at least one pregnancy (n = 84) a significant association with pregnancy loss (p < 0.005) and especially with early pregnancy loss (p < 0.0001) was demonstrated. No association with other immunoglobulin subtypes of antiprothrombin antibodies could be documented. In the subgroup of patients with primary APS and at least one pregnancy in the history, pregnancy loss (p < 0.005) and early pregnancy loss (p < 0.0001) were found to be highly associated with the presence of IgG antiprothrombin antibodies. IgG antiprothrombin antibodies represent the highest independent risk factor for pregnancy loss with an odds ratio of 4.5. There was no statistically significant association with venous or arterial thrombosis in all IgG antiprothrombin antibody positive patients. CONCLUSION The results of this study document the association of IgG antiprothrombin antibodies with pregnancy loss and in particular early pregnancy loss in a large and well-characterized cohort of patients. We would recommend routine testing for antiprothrombin antibodies in young female patients with APS.

Abstract
True (cofactor-independent) anticardiolipin antibodies (aCL) are thought to lack lupus anticoagulant (LA) activity and pathogenic potential. A serum monoclonal immunoglobulin Mlambda (mIgMlambda) with aCL and LA activities found in a man with a splenicIgMlambda+ B-cell lymphoplasmacytic lymphoma (LPL) without thrombotic events has been characterized. LPL-derived hybridoma clones (designated HY-FRO) producing the serum mIgMlambda were obtained. mIgMlambda secreted by HY-FRO grown in protein-free culture medium, like that purified from serum, (i) showed binding, in a cofactor-free system, to solid-phase CL and phosphatidylserine (PS) and to the membrane of PS-expressing cells (apoptotic cells and activated platelets); (ii) failed to bind neutral phospholipids (PL), beta2Glycoprotein, histone, ssDNA, dsDNA, human IgG and umbilical vein endothelial cells. Absorption with apoptotic cells abolished its binding to anionic plate-bound CL and PS. IgMlambda-FRO used poorly mutated VH and Vlambda region genes, with a pattern that was inconsistent with an antigen-driven selection. Basic amino acids were present in the IgH complementarity determining region 3 (CDR3), which can be important for binding to anionic PL. These findings demonstrate unequivocally that true anti-anionic PL IgM antibodies can exert LA and indicate this anti-PL type does not involve thrombophilia.

Abstract
The present review highlights recent studies that investigated the possible influences of autoimmune factors in reproductive success or failure. These factors include antiphospholipid antibodies, antithyroid antibodies, antinuclear antibodies, antisperm antibodies, and antiovarian antibodies. The majority of recent work has focused on these potential autoimmune factors; however, controversy still exists over indicated testing and treatment options. An association of antiphospholipid antibodies and recurrent pregnancy loss has been established, and treatment with subcutaneous heparin appears most efficacious. Other autoimmune factors are under investigation as markers of in-vitro fertilization failure. Limited data from treatment trials are presented.

Abstract
Sixty percent of recurrent spontaneous abortions are unexplained. Antiphospholipid syndrome is a multisystem disease with the predominant features of venous and arterial thrombosis, recurrent pregnancy loss, foetal death and the presence of antiphospholipid antibodies. Many epidemiological studies focus on antiphospholipid autoantibodies syndrome (APS) as a cause of recurrent spontaneous abortion (RSA). It is found that 7-25% of RSA would have APS as the main risk factor. 'Association not being synonymous with cause', the proportion of abortions due to the APS is difficult to estimate for several reasons: definition of recurrent abortion is variable, the assays for antiphospholipid antibodies are not well standardised, inclusion of patients in the study group according to the antibodies titre is author dependent. Recent studies suggest association of antiphospholipid antibodies syndrome not only with recurrent abortions but also with infertility. New mechanisms are described by which antiphospholipid antibodies could cause placental thrombosis and infarction, acting directly on the surface anticoagulant expressed on trophoblastic cells. Only lupus anticoagulant (LA) and anticardiolipin antibodies (aCL) assays are sufficiently standardised to be usable in routine. Testing for other antiphospholipid antibodies (aPLs) should remain investigational. Several treatments have been proposed: low doses of aspirin, low or immunosuppressive doses of corticosteroids, and preventive or effective dose of heparin, intravenous immunoglobulin.

Abstract
The obstetric management of women with antiphospholipid (aPL) syndrome remains controversial. Despite recent advances, the controversies have been fueled by our limited understanding of the multi-factorial causes of aPL-associated pregnancy loss and the lack of data from randomized studies. We have escaped from the narrow confines of the concept of aPL pregnancy loss being purely thrombotic in aetiology and attention is now focused on the adverse effects of aPL on embryonic implantation and trophoblast invasion. Combined treatment with aspirin and heparin has been demonstrated in two randomized studies to lead to a high live birth rate in aPL pregnancies. However, successful pregnancies are characterized by a high rate of perinatal complications and some women are refractory to this treatment combination. In addition to addressing these issues, multi-centre studies, which should perhaps be internet based, are needed to identify those aPL that are causative of pregnancy complications and those that are not, the role of IVIG and the long-term follow-up of both mothers with aPL and their babies.

Abstract
The diagnosis of antiphospholipid syndrome (APS) requires the presence of both clinical and biological features. Due to the heterogeneity of anti-phospholipid antibodies (aPL) the laboratory approach for their detection includes clotting-based tests for lupus anticoagulant (LA) as well as solid-phase assays for anticardiolipin antibodies (aCL). In addition, as it has been shown that autoimmune aPL recognize epitopes on phospholipid (PL)-binding plasma proteins, assays detecting antibodies to beta 2-glycoprotein I (beta 2-GPI) or prothrombin have been developed. The association between venous or arterial thrombosis and recurrent fetal loss with the presence of conventional aPL (LA and/or aCL) has been confirmed by many studies. The LA and IgG aCL at moderate/high titre seem to exhibit the strongest association with clinical manifestations of the APS. Several reports indicate that LA is less sensitive but more specific than aCL for the APS. Assays against PLs other than CL as well as the use of mixtures of PLs have been proposed to improve the detection of APS-related aPL. Concerning antibodies to PL-binding proteins (detected in the absence of PLs), there is evidence that anti-beta 2-GPI are closely associated with thrombosis and other clinical features of the APS. Moreover, these antibodies may be more specific in the recognition of the APS and in some cases may be present in the absence of aPL detected by standard tests. Many issues are still under debate and are discussed in this review, such as the problems of standardization of anti-beta 2-GPI assays, detection of the IgA isotype of aCL and anti-beta 2-GPI, the coagulation profiles of LA in the recognition of the thrombotic risk and the association of particular markers with subsets of patients with APS.
